SUMMARY
In this InMode Educational Series, Dr. Heather Roberts offers a deep dive into the scientific principles and clinical applications of Lumecca IPL. Drawing on over a decade of hands-on use, she explains how this advanced IPL technology achieves high efficacy in treating both vascular and pigmented lesions, setting a new standard in non-ablative skin rejuvenation.
TOPICS COVERED
- The differences between IPL and laser and their roles in photothermolysis
- How wavelength, pulse duration, and cooling affect treatment outcomes
- Melanin and hemoglobin absorption curves and their relevance in targeting lesions
- Fitzpatrick skin type considerations and treatment safety limits (up to Type IV)
- Filter selection: 515nm vs. 580nm for superficial vs. deeper chromophores
- Case studies: face, hands, chest, scars, and vascular conditions
- Real-time patient response as the key to adjusting energy levels
